Florfenicol
300 mg/ml
Brand Name: Nabaflor Inj
Dosage form: Solution for Injection
Route of administration: Injection

Florfenicol
300 mg/ml
Cattle:
Diseases caused by florfenicol susceptible bacteria: Treatment of respiratory tract infections in cattle due to Mannheimia haemolytica, Pasteurella multocida, and Histophilus somni.
Sheep:
Treatment of ovine respiratory tract infections due to Mannheimia haemolytica and Pasteurella multocida.
Pigs:
Treatment of acute outbreaks of swine respiratory disease caused by strains of Actinobacillus pleuropneumoniae and Pasteurella multocida.

Oxytetracycline dihydrate
300 mg/ml
Brand Name: Nabatetracyklin Inj
Dosage form: Solution for injection
Route of administration: Injection

Oxytetracycline dihydrate
300 mg/ml
For the treatment of conditions caused by or associated with organisms sensitive to oxytetracycline including:
Bordetella bronchiseptica
Actinomyces pyogenes
Erysipelothrix rhusiopathiae
Pasteurella spp
Staphylococcus spp
Streptococcus spp
Certain mycoplasma, rickettsiae, protozoa, and chlamydia are also sensitive to oxytetracycline.
The product is indicated for the treatment and control of:
- Pasteurellosis
- Pneumonia
- Atrophic rhinitis
- Erysipelas
- Joint-ill
- Navel-ill
- Summer mastitis in cows
- Ovine keratoconjunctivitis (pink-eye)
- Enzootic abortion in sheep

Tilmicosin
300 mg/ml
Brand Name: Nabatilcosin Injection
Dosage form: Solution for Injection
Route of administration: Injection

Tilmicosin
300 mg/ml
Cattle:
- Treatment of bovine respiratory disease associated with Mannheimia haemolytica and Pasteurella multocida.
- Treatment of interdigital necrobacillosis.
Sheep:
- Treatment of respiratory tract infections caused by Mannheimia haemolytica and Pasteurella multocida.
- Treatment of foot rot in sheep caused by Dichelobacter nodosus and Fusobacterium necrophorum.
- Treatment of acute ovine mastitis caused by Staphylococcus aureus and Mycoplasma agalactiae.
